Abstract
Neural Radiance Fields (NeRF) revolutionized novel view synthesis in recent years by offering a new volumetric representation, which is compact and provides high-quality image rendering. However, the methods to edit those radiance fields developed slower than the many improvements to other aspects of NeRF. With the recent development of alternative radiance field-based representations inspired by NeRF as well as the worldwide rise in popularity of text-to-image models, many new opportunities and strategies have emerged to provide radiance field editing. In this paper, we deliver a comprehensive survey of the different editing methods present in the literature for NeRF and other similar radiance field representations. We propose a new taxonomy for classifying existing works based on their editing methodologies, review pioneering models, reflect on current and potential new applications of radiance field editing, and compare state-of-the-art approaches in terms of editing options and performance.
